Understanding Caffeine and Pregnancy
🧠 Mother says: While iced coffees can be a delightful treat, it's crucial to monitor your caffeine intake during pregnancy. High caffeine levels have been linked to potential impacts on the baby’s heart rate and development. By choosing decaf or limiting your intake, you can enjoy your iced coffee without worry. Remember, moderation is key and each sip should be a moment of joy.

FAQs
Is decaf iced coffee safe during pregnancy?
Yes, decaf iced coffee is generally considered safe during pregnancy as it contains minimal amounts of caffeine.
How does caffeine affect my baby?
High levels of caffeine can influence your baby's heart rate and development, so it's important to manage intake carefully.
